Nawaka villagers in high spirits following arrival of Duke and Duchess of Sussex in Nadi

Villagers of Nawaka Nadi are in high spirit this morning as they will be performing the traditional farewell ceremony for the Duke and Duchess of Sussex, Prince Harry and Meghan Markle at the Nadi International Airport.

The traditional ceremony that is scheduled to begin around 11am today is significant for the people of Nawaka as one of their very own, the Late Sergeant Talaiasi Labalaba will be honoured with a statue for his bravery and service towards the crown, Fiji and Britain as a whole.

52 year old, Isaia Dere who is the son of the late Fijian Hero Sergeant Labalaba will also be present at the farewell and unveiling ceremony this morning.

The Duke and Duchess of Sussex, Prince Harry and Meghan Markle will today pay tribute to the Fijian hero who was in the British special forces as part of their final official engagement in Fiji before travelling to Tonga.

The statue will be erected at the Nadi International Airport.
